Read more about BDSwiss in our comprehensive review where we also assign an FX Trust Score based on five key criteria we deem to be of utmost importance to traders.
Read more about Admirals (Admiral Markets) in our comprehensive review where we also assign an FX Trust Score based on five key criteria we deem to be of utmost importance to traders.